Transaction 881b98f3261e5cbdc921ab41b47fe2da55473f561c3aea04a525765627d80c17

2 Input
2 Outputs
  • 881b98f3261e5cbdc921ab41b47fe2da55473f561c3aea04a525765627d80c17:0
  • value  1872529
    address  1ABxAfahJC4KLz3RofTkofN3nYPJgNJS41
  • 881b98f3261e5cbdc921ab41b47fe2da55473f561c3aea04a525765627d80c17:1
  • value  11307001
    address  3LvMbKse7jSoSD1mbGVdGrD8kFW6XYTP7y